    FATEs just have no impact. IF we take GW2 which actually implemented them well, failing succeeding a dynamic event actually has an effect on the map/surrounding. Maybe a town will be taken over/liberated, maybe a path will be swarming with enemies instead of being guarded by allies. Hell a chain of those even affects the entrance to a dungeon! FATEs in this game have no consequence and give barely any reward of worthwhile importance, so why care?
